The Resource Room houses the Art building's
circulating AV equipment and serves as a slide and digital image review
space for students in selected courses. It also houses a collection of
duplicate slides used for teaching and student review. Some classes have
their review slides sent to the OUGL Resource Room.
General Equipment Pool:
Resource Room equipment is available to faculty, instructors, and TAs
for classroom use. To reserve a piece of equipment, be sure to sign up
on the designated calendar in the Resource Room.
Slide projector
Video projector with VCR
Video monitor with VCR |
Overhead projector
Projection screen
VHS camcorder and tripod |
Laser pointer
CD and tape player
|
Please note:
* Equipment is not available for personal use.
* Checkout is limited to the length of a class (except camcorder/tripod,
which may be used outside of class for documenting demonstrations, exhibits,
guest lectures, and recording work-in-progress).
* Resource Room does not provide videocassettes.
* Undergraduate students are not eligible to borrow equipment.
The Resource Room urges users to be extremely cautious with all
equipment. Funds may not be available to replace equipment that is irreparably
damaged or stolen.

Room 309:
Room 309 has a copystand with
electronic strobes and a studio
photography space with tungsten floodlights and a variety of backdrop
cloths. A camera and tripod are also available. To use Room 309 and its
equipment, make an appointment through the Resource Room. There is
no charge for faculty to use this room.
Circulating Cameras:
A 35mm SLR Camera is available for use on or adjacent to the School of
Art grounds for documenting installations, class projects, etc. To use
the circulating camera, make an appointment through the Resource Room.
Two Canon digital cameras are available for faculty & staff checkout
as well.
